Ciao,
devo eseguire un metodo che restituisca il numero di nodi dell'albero che hanno almeno due figli, non riesco a formare il cilclo per far andare avanti il controllo, se faccio un metodo ricorsivo cosa metto come parametro al metodo? posto il codice da me svuiluppato
codice:
   public int contaBiGenitori() {
   
    return contaBiGenitori(root);
   }
   
  public int contaBiGenitori(BinaryNode node) {
   int cont=0;;
    try {
     if((node.getLeftChild() != null) && (node.getRightChild() != null)) {//qui controllo la radice
    	cont++;
    }
   }
   catch(NullPointerException e) {
    if(root==null)
     System.out.println("Albero vuoto" + e);
   }
return cont;  }
Grazie.